Может bitcoind/с Bitcoin-Qt в (Через или командной строки-параметры RPC) используется, чтобы обнаружить, когда существуют две конкурирующие лучшие блоки?

Стандартный bitcoind/биткойн-клиент на Qt можно задать на самый высокий блок, с помощью RPC, или получать уведомления, когда новые 'лучшая защита' локально признал (по -blocknotify вариант).

Но, есть ли способ, чтобы сказать, когда более чем одно одинаково-высокие блоки циркулируют, и, таким образом, еще не ясно, что победит? Или все-таки стандартный клиент остается заблокированным только на первый блок, который он получает, пока не получит окончательно-длинную цепь?

+568
Pamps 11 февр. 2019 г., 3:57:00
23 ответов

Есть какие-то справочники или материалы, доступные за помощь в создании специализированного оборудования ASIC для bitcoin-майнинга .

+952
zico69 03 февр. '09 в 4:24

Я получил это работает на моем Mac (ОС Х Маверикс 10.9.0), используя http://spaceman.ca/cgminerно первые шаги первой. Откройте терминал и введите:

судо kextunload -б ком.яблоко.водитель.AppleUSBCDC
судо kextunload -б ком.яблоко.водитель.AppleUSBCDCACMData

Он будет просить у вас пароль администратора. Он не попросит у вас во второй строке (так как вы только недавно ввели свой пароль, то не нужно его снова в течение нескольких минут).

Затем откройте мое приложение cgminer и введите его в поле:

-о имя-пула:номер_порта -U имя_пользователя -P пароль
+783
bl17zar 22 окт. 2015 г., 11:58:38

Много людей, что мы знаем о и, вероятно, многое другое, чего мы не знаем о разработке различных финансовых инструментов для Bitcoin. Какие инструменты точно будет зависеть от вашего определения документа.

Вот это интересно:

cvToken: Усилия по стабилизации цен Bitcoin с помощью разметки маркером, подкрепленные товаров к нему.

+672
RyBOT 12 янв. 2015 г., 18:46:54

Бы этот код на Python создать действительный закрытый ключ алгоритма ECDSA?

импорт случайных

деф Р(А, Б):
 sys_ran = случайное.SystemRandom()
 возвращение sys_ran.randint(A, Б)

деф create_private_key():
 0123456789ABCDEF hex_chars =''
 ran_hex = ";

 Для я в диапазоне(64):
 ran_hex += hex_chars[Р(0, 15)]

 FF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FEBAAEDCE6AF48A03BBFD25E8CD0364141 max_hex =''

 если int(ran_hex, 16) <= инт(max_hex, 16):
 возвращение ran_hex
другое:
 возвращение create_private_key()

private_key = create_private_key()
печать('секретный ключ:' + private_key)

Насколько я могу сказать с биткоин Вики, с уровнем закрытый ключ любой 64 шестнадцатеричных (или соответствующее десятичное) число между 0x1 и 0xFFFFFFFFFFFFFFFFFFFFFFFFFFFFFFfebaaedce6af48a03bbfd25e8cd0364141. Ничего не сказано о каких-либо специальных алгоритмов, необходимых для закрытого ключа, чтобы быть действительным.

+623
automatix 19 февр. 2014 г., 19:44:00

Я заинтересована в развитии крипто-валюта (кто не), но я не заинтересован в Blockchain горно аспект. Я хочу программу, которая излучает монеты, когда кто-то совершил какой-проверена работа в Реале.

Так, это все равно требует использования блокчейна?

+618
Milova 26 июл. 2013 г., 4:34:56

Я заметил, что многие биткойн-адреса, начинающиеся с цифры или прописные буквы. Я понимаю, что все адреса начинаются с цифры один, но я могу создать адрес с второй символ в нижнем регистре? Это значительно труднее для создания адреса с несколькими строчные буквы в начале? Существуют ли другие ограничения в отношении генерирующих тщеславие адреса?

+570
19701801 19 дек. 2018 г., 9:09:20

Кажется, что Blockchain.info, в частности, соответствует биткоин в JSON RPC в АПИ. Что дано, можно использовать наиболее распространенные языки программирования, чтобы открыть свой бумажник, последнее, но не менее простой биткоин-интерфейс командной строки команды, от первоначального распределения биткоин:

$ биткоин-кли -rpcconnect=rpc.blockchain.info -чтобы=443 -rpcssl -rpcuser=YourWalletIdentifier -rpcpassword=getinfo ваш пароль 

-rpcconnect=rpc.blockchain.info проинструктирует биткоин-интерфейса командной строки для подключения к blockchain.info с RPC интерфейс; -чтобы=443 задает удаленный порт; -rpcssl должен требовать SSL-соединения; -rpcuser и -rpcpassword говорят сами за себя.

Последнее слово, getinfo, является самой команде.

В вашем случае, это должно быть нечто вроде:

importaddress <bitcoinaddress> "" ложные

где importaddress является команда (или метод), который предписывает кошелек для включения <bitcoinaddress> в кошелек себе. Поскольку вы не указываете секретный ключ-адресу, но только в адрес себя, он станет "смотреть адрес" внутри вашего кошелька: вы сможете отслеживать его состояние, но не для трансляции операций, который включает его. Пара двойных кавычек "" может быть заменен бумажник имя, если вы его установили. ложь - это логическое значение, которое указывает, что биткоин двигатель не пересканировать весь блокчейн операций, который включает адрес, который вы добавляете. Я не blockchain.info клиента, так что я не знаю последствий этого конкретного флага. Я считаю, что это ОК, чтобы установить его истинные, так blockchain.info сканирует блокчейн в реальном времени.

+567
Tony Giaccone 13 апр. 2011 г., 17:29:03

Если вы зашифруете свой кошелек, он также будет зашифрован по всем адресам Ваш когда-нибудь создать. Биткоин Qt будет просить вас за каждую транзакцию пароль.

Значит ли это, что любой может использовать средства у меня в бумажнике на компьютер, без моего пароля?

На данный момент да, попробуйте снова зашифровать его, может быть, ты сделал misstake?

Статус сделки на компьютер Б тоже, 8 подтверждений? Является ли это признаком ошибки. Кроме того, 'от' помечено как неизвестное - это важно?

Подтверждение означает, что транзакция прошла успешно добавлен в блок и обрабатывается. Некоторых рынков или платформ требуется определенное количество подтверждений. Ваш платеж будет нормальный подтверждено после 1 подтверждения.

Также нет значка замка на Qt клиента, которые, как мне сказали там должно быть, если кошелек зашифрован?

Да, там должен быть значок "замок" справа внизу. Попытаться снова защитить свой кошелек, это возможно.

+556
Lex Luthor 6 мар. 2012 г., 15:01:23

Я готов поставить некоторые из моих БТЦ предприятием в пару различные холодные кошельки для хранения. Я прошел через процесс уже движется вокруг нескольких Мбитс как испытания, созданные ключи на автономном ПК, отправлено реальные средства, затем побежал импорта в Bitcoin-Qt, то все там хорошо!

Мой интерес заключается в следующем, если я перенесу несколько бтц на отдельные 1BTC кошельки, я должен беспокоиться о каких-либо изменения решения проблем, если я просто игнорировать их полностью в течение длительного времени? Предполагая, что мои приватные ключи хранятся в течение долгого времени, есть ли способ я могу потерять средства таким образом? Я не планирую делать дальнейшие депозиты на любой из этих кошельков, если мои средства вырастет я буду держать другой кошелек или установки более холодного хранения. Я тоже не планирую выводить средства в любое время, когда у меня это будет полная зачистка в бумажник.

Прежде чем я продолжу с отправкой мой жесткий заработанные майнинг BTC на каждый адрес, я хочу убедиться, что я принять все меры предосторожности, любая помощь от вас плюсы БТЦ благодарностью.

+545
Hanns Broun 26 сент. 2018 г., 4:57:13

Я записалась на harborly счет, но я еще не совсем уверен, как это работает. Я хотел бы купить биткоины, но как мне получить деньги на сайте?

+538
SvenBr 1 сент. 2013 г., 3:41:53

Вы можете найти другой блокатор.Ио лайткоин блок Эксплорер для Alt валюты.

Bockr.Ио Лайткоин блок Эксплорер

+509
Alexander Rutz 22 авг. 2016 г., 4:50:00

Тонкие клиенты (СПВ)

  • MultiBit.org
    • Инструменты -> экспорт закрытых ключей -> откройте файл, который вы экспортировали
  • grabHive.com (только для Mac)
    • Экспорт пока не реализовано

Надстройки браузера

  • SpareCoins.Ио(хром)
    • Значок -> ключ резервного копирования бумажник (в зашифрованном виде)

Полное Клиентами

  • Биткоин-Кварты
    • Помощь -> окно отладки -> консоль
      • walletpassphrase {пароль} {ожидания}
      • dumpwallet {именем} (рекомендуемый способ, сваливает все бумажник ключи в человека-readble формат, в файл с именем filename)
      • dumpprivkey {bitcoinaddress} (дополнительный метод, экспорт закрытого ключа)

Клиенты с Детерминистические кошельки

  • BitcoinArmory.com
    • Свойства -> Бумажник Индивидуальными Ключами -> Резервное Копирование Закрытого Ключа (Обычный Base58)
  • Electrum.org
    • Экспорт -> личные ключи -> откройте экспортированный файл

Гибридные Веб-Кошельки

  • StrongCoin.com
    • Ваши аккаунты -> выберите -> расшифровать приватный ключ (с пароль)
  • BlockChain.info
    • Импорт/экспорт -> Экспорт в незашифрованном виде -> ищем 5*, л* и к* личные ключи

Кошельки Андроид

  • Mycelium.com

    • Ключи -> (параметры-бар |) -> экспорт
    • (Устарело) управление ключами -> (параметры) -> экспортировать на SD-карту(JPG в "мицелий-экспорт папки"), QR-код или в буфер обмена
  • BitcoinSpinner

    • (Параметры) -> настройки -> дополнительно -> экспорт закрытого ключа -> QR-код или буфер обмена
  • Биткоин кошелек (Андреас Шильдбах)

    • (Параметры) -> резервное копирование ключей (зашифрованные)
      • в OpenSSL энк -д -алгоритма AES-256-CBC С -а-в

.... будет больше времени, надеюсь сохранить этот ответ обновлен

+507
GalB1t 25 авг. 2016 г., 4:34:06

Частные адреса.

У них есть биткоин-адрес каждого акционера и каждую неделю они делают платеж по этому адресу, пропорционально количеству акций, которыми он владеет.

Это одна из див-расчетных операций (есть несколько из них каждую среду): http://blockchain.info/tx/8e26e8fd5eada1dc5d5125b39db66129bb55645d654b4c6dfc4a0611f3de358d

+436
Qumo 16 сент. 2012 г., 18:42:22

Начнем с печально известного биткоин.conf, который не существует, и никто не знает точно, как он должен прийти в существование.

Ну, я знаю.

Он должен прийти в существование, вы создаете его с помощью текстового редактора в переменной datadir каталог, если вы хотите сделать так. Это совершенно необязательно. Если есть параметры командной строки, которые вы хотите использовать в любое время без того, чтобы указать их (например, -txindex=1), Вы можете положить их в биткоин.конф. Если вы счастливы, продолжая давать их в командной строке, то нет необходимости в биткоин.конф существовать вообще.

И теперь вы тоже знаете.


Что касается вашего другого вопроса, если вы используете getblockchaininfo вместо getinfo, вы получите более подробную информацию. Текущие версии ядра биткоин попробовать скачать заголовки блоков, прежде чем сами блоки. Вы увидите заголовки полей в getblockchaininfo , который, возможно, будет увеличиваться.

В противном случае, любые диагностические данные будут в файле под названием "отладка".войдите в свой datadir не каталог. Посмотрите на этот файл. Если это не требует пояснений, то вы можете размещать последние несколько строк в вопрос здесь, или на других ваших любимых биткоин форум поддержки.

+410
Lora Mehringer 3 мар. 2010 г., 12:20:31

mSIGNA является multisignature кошелек для биткоин. Сайт Продукта.

+375
irbiz 10 окт. 2016 г., 16:50:16

Пожалуйста, помогите! Я получил .116 биткоин на свой счет Электрум, а затем отправили .115 Bitcoin на мой рынок счета сне. Раздражающе низкая плата появилась на Электрума (см. скриншот).

enter image description here

Я добавил еще один .0108 биткоин на счет Электрум, полагая, что это заставит оплаты через так как будет достаточно баланса, чтобы увидеть его - но безрезультатно!Сообщение я получаю на рынок мечта-вы ожидающий входящий депозит ฿0.115. Подтверждение занимает 20 минут (2 подтверждения) в среднем'. (см. скриншот 2) enter image description here

Есть ли способ, чтобы либо отменить этот платеж и повторить и заставить его через а это было 27 часов и я не думаю, что это право себе?

Я читал другие биткоин форумах с подобными проблемами к тому, что я испытываю, но я новичок и читая некоторые ответы, как учить совсем другой язык.

Любое простое решение с основными пошаговое руководство будет высоко ценится

+335
bajji 21 янв. 2016 г., 7:44:12

Я считаю, что поведение вы видите, это действительно ошибка.

По умолчанию, addmultisigaddress использует p2sh-segwit по умолчанию тип адреса для кошелька. По умолчанию createmultisig использует наследие. Эти два различных типа адреса, и обычно, вы получаете два разных адреса.

Однако segwit не допускает открытых ключей несжатый. Поэтому, когда redeemScript создается, если открытый ключ несжатого обнаруживается, как РСПК вернется устаревших адресов. Вот почему вы видите один и тот же адрес во втором примере.

Но я считаю, что это ошибка. Ваш первый пример должен также дать такие же устаревшие адреса, но это не так. Я думаю, что это потому, что без сжатия по умолчанию не является частью бумажника, поэтому он не правильно определяет, что это несжатый умолчанию. Таким образом addmultisigaddress следует его по умолчанию, чтобы дать вам p2sh-segwit адреса и createmultisig следует его по умолчанию, чтобы дать вам наследие адресу.

Чтения необработанных данных транзакции в блокчейне, как можно узнать, будет ли скрипт должен быть хэширован использование устаревших или segwit?

Для p2sh-segwit, в redeemScript фактически не redeemScript вы получаете от ЭКП. А это скрипт для вывода P2WSH. В "redeemScript" на самом деле witnessScript для сценария P2WSH это реальная redeemScript. Тип сценария (либо в scriptPubKey или в redeemScript) определить, что выход segwit или нет.

+260
Casebash 28 мар. 2011 г., 12:24:33

Традиционных банков не держите биткоин на своих счетах, так что вы не можете отправлять биткоины на ваш счет. Что вы можете сделать, это продать свои биткоины на фиатные деньги и что Fiat зачислены на ваш банковский счет. Есть много компаний, готовых купить ваш биткоин на фиатные деньги.

Что касается выдавая свой адрес для транзакции, то есть не то, что вам нужно сделать, когда вы отправляете биткоины человеку. Bitcoin-это система, где вы нажимаете средств для кого-то, нежели дать им полномочия, чтобы вытащить их из тебя. После этого, им удастся определить ваш адрес, но это не так уж механизм вы используете, чтобы платить кому-то, и это не важно для получателя. Это аналогично, если вы платите кому-то деньги. После этого они смогут увидеть серийные номера на купюрах, но они не заботятся, ни были эти цифры, необходимой им для совершения сделки происходят.

+237
Bernardo Mosquea 30 июн. 2019 г., 19:30:33

Теперь, МТ. Гора Gox больше не предлагает МТГ обменять коды долларов США, что другие биржи предлагают эти ваучеры / обменять коды / купоны?

+189
Hunter 27 мар. 2013 г., 18:38:24

Есть ли разница в структуре segwit блока по сравнению с традиционным не segwit блок? Схема будет полезна, если возможно.

+116
Marjorie Dawn Edwards 24 окт. 2014 г., 1:39:16

Пока P2SH-P2WPKH UTXO тратятся и redeemScript подвергается, а P2SH-P2WPKH адрес неотличима от не-segwit P2SH-адрес (например для segwit мульти-подписи адрес)

Ссылка: https://bitcoincore.org/en/segwit_wallet_dev/

Потому что P2SH адрес еще хэш скрипта, независимо от того, скрипт внедренный P2WPKH скрипт или обычный старый сценарий сценарий. Так что вы не можете 'расшифровать' его обратно в скрипт, вам нужно ждать, пока сам скрипт обнародованы при погашении выходной.

+98
Amiko Malania 11 окт. 2010 г., 23:53:03

Я чувствую, что существующие ответы здесь не подчеркнуть, что в то время (сборник) шахтеры имеют право выбирать порядок операций, а также вводить дополнительные действия правил, они не имеют право определять, какие правила существуют.

Segwit2X (в моем понимании, там, кажется, несколько идей оттуда) представляется сочетанием мягкой вилки (активация SegWit) и планирую сделать жесткую вилку позже (изменив некоторые ограничения на ресурсы). Первое это то, что шахтеры могут сделать, а во-вторых, только полные узлы, которые реализуют те же правила, и игнорировать все остальные.

+86
Anguel Roumenov Bogoev 4 сент. 2016 г., 12:36:20

Я по-прежнему использовать Bitcoin 0.13.2 по некоторым причинам. Последние размер mempool очень высока, поэтому синхронизация mempool занимает длительное время, в течение двух дней. Есть ли способы синхронизации mempool быстрее? У меня есть некоторые узлы bitcoind. Некоторые из них уже закончил синхронизацию полный mempool. Я надеюсь, что я могу копировать mempool с моим другом узлов.

+49
sevenbrokenbricks 9 сент. 2014 г., 20:54:43

Показать вопросы с тегом